Abstract

This study aims to describe and analyze the implementation, supporting and inhibiting factors, and evaluation of the mandatory Iqra' extracurricular program at Budisatrya Private Junior High School Medan. This program was initiated in 2015 as a response to the low ability of students to read the Qur'an due to the lack of parental attention and the dominance of gadget use. This research is a descriptive qualitative research. Data collection is carried out through observation, interview, and documentation techniques, with data analysis techniques including data reduction, data presentation, and conclusion drawn. The research data sources are the principal, the iqra' extracurricular coach, the Iqra' extracurricular coordinator, and students who participate in iqra' extracurricular activities at the Budisatrya Private Junior High School in Medan. The results of the study showed that: First, the implementation of the program began with a diagnostic test that netted 79 students, followed by a homogeneous grouping into three study groups every Saturday. Learning applies a variety of methods (bandongan, sorogan, Qiraati, and Wafa) as well as a peer tutor system, with the sorogan method as the most dominant and effective method. Second, the supporting factors of the program include strict policies of school leaders, the competence of supervisors of S1 PAI graduates, motivational support from parents, and the existence of peer motivation. Meanwhile, the inhibiting factors are the low interest of students, the dominance of the use of gadgets that interfere with murajaah, and limited time allocation. Third, program evaluation runs systematically through monthly process evaluation using a monitoring book and evaluation of results in the form of practical exams at the end of the semester. The results of the evaluation in the sample class (VII-1) showed a significant increase in the ability to read the Qur'an individually, where the majority of students managed to increase the volume level (Iqra') even until they were declared passed. Based on these results, the Iqra' extracurricular program must prove effective in improving the Qur'an reading ability of students at Budisatrya Medan Private Junior High School.
